Jurrjens makes Braves roster, in disbelief

Braves rookie pitcher Jair Jurrjens said a few weeks ago that he wouldn't assume he had made the squad until someone from the team told him it was so.

He's listed in the Braves game notes as the starter for Game 3 on Wednesday against Pittsburgh. Cox confirmed the order to the media Thursday.

But Jurrjens said he hasn't been told by anyone.

"I suppose that means I made the team," he said. "I'm still not going to believe it till I fly to Washington [for the season opener Sunday]. I'm not telling anyone. I'm still waiting."

He laughed.

"That [plan] could change. You always have to be prepared."

Jurrjens also will start tonight's exhibition game at Turner Field against Cleveland, facing Indians ace Fausto Carmona.
